Understanding Grief: Delving into Therapeutic Approaches

Grief is a profound and deeply personal experience that can manifest in myriad ways. When faced with the loss of a loved one, relationship, or significant life change, individuals often grapple with intense emotions, such as check here sadness, anger, guilt, and confusion. These feelings are valid, and it is crucial to recognize them as part of the healing process.

Therapeutic approaches offer a valuable structure for navigating grief and fostering resilience. Professionals trained in grief counseling provide a safe and supportive space where individuals can verbalize their pain, process their loss, and develop coping tools.

Some common therapeutic approaches to grief include:

  •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T)
  • Shared Healing Circles
  • Art Therapy

These techniques aim to help individuals process their grief, develop healthier coping patterns, and ultimately find meaning and purpose in their lives despite the loss.

Healing from Grief: Resources and Techniques for Coping

Grief is a universal experience that can be profoundly difficult. It's crucial to remember that there's no right or wrong way to grieve, and the process is unique to each individual. When you navigate this complex journey, know that you don't have to go through it alone.

There are many options available to help you cope with grief and start on the path to healing. Explore joining a support group where you can connect with others who understand what you're going through. Talking to a therapist or counselor can also provide invaluable direction.

  • Furthermore, self-care practices like exercise can be helpful in managing grief's emotional and physical toll.
  • Keep in mind that healing from grief takes time. Be patient with yourself, allow yourself to feel your emotions, and find the support you need.
